The Pittsburgh Steelers are weighing their options regarding quarterback Aaron Rodgers' future amid concerns about his performance. One report suggests that if Rodgers has a poor first month this season, the team may explore benching him or moving on, depending on his play and injury status. Despite being over 40 years old, Rodgers has displayed a strong football IQ, which may keep him in the mix even if his physical performance declines. The Steelers' coaching staff respects his experience, indicating any major decisions would be carefully considered during the season.
